Sa’ada Hosts Grand Scout Parade for Summer School Students

Sa'ada: The Sub-Committee for Summer Activities, Courses, and Public Mobilization in Sa'ada governorate recently organized a significant scout parade, drawing thousands of students from summer schools across the districts of Sa'ada, Sahar, al-Safra, and Majz. The event was graced by the presence of local officials, executive office directors, public mobilization leaders, and community members.

According to Yemen News Agency, Governor Mohammed Awad addressed the assembly, congratulating the students on their successful completion of the summer programs. He commended the organizers and teachers for their dedication in realizing the educational and cultural goals of the courses. The governor emphasized that the students would return to formal education enriched with knowledge, discipline, and Quranic values.

Deputy Minister of Education and Scientific Research for the Basic Education Sector Hadi Ammar also lauded the outcomes of the summer activities, acknowledging the pivotal role of teachers and staff in educating and guiding students. A student representative delivered a speech highlighting the summer schools as crucial platforms for cultural, educational, and skills development, which help participants enhance their awareness, discipline, and social responsibility.

Participants underscored the necessity of continuing such programs that support youth development and reinforce educational and moral values among younger generations.
